NY R00494 June 29, 2004 CLA-2-94:RR:NC:SP:233 R00494 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 9401.90.1010 Mr. Joseph Fogmeg Seton Company - Leather Division 849 Broadway Newark, NJ 07001 RE: The tariff classification of “Cut Sets for Car Seats” from various countries. Dear Mr. Fogmeg: In your letter dated June 24, 2004, you requested a tariff classification ruling. The merchandise to be imported is referred to in the Automotive Industry as “Cut Sets for Car Seats,” consisting of pieces of leather to be made into car seat covers. The pieces are specifically made for a particular make and model of a car. They are cut to size and dedicated as parts of automobile seats. The leather products are made from bovine (including buffalo) or equine animals, without hair. You have submitted illustrative literature, photographs, a product information sheet and product process flow charts with your request. The applicable subheading for the “Cut Sets for Car Seats” will be 9401.90.1010,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for “Seats (other than those of heading 9402), whether or not convertible into beds, and parts thereof: Parts: Of seats of a kind used for motor vehicles, Of leather, cut to shape.” The rate of duty will be free.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). A copy of the ruling or the control number indicated above should be provided with the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ported.
